Boulder City's tournament run continued when they took on Buchanan on Saturday. The Eagles fell 2-0 to the Bears. The Eagles have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Ivy Dineen paced Boulder City's offense, picking up five kills. Dineen got some help from Laylani Gubler and her seven assists. Gubler was also solid from the service line: she led the team with three aces.
Buchanan's victory was a true team effort,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Avery Dedekian, who had four digs and two aces.
Boulder City's loss dropped their record down to 1-4. As for Buchanan, the win keeps them at an undefeated 6-0.
Boulder City has already played their next contest, a 2-1 defeat against Somerset Sky Pointe on the 16th. As for Buchanan,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next game, a 2-1 victory against Durango on the 16th.
